Abstract(in English) The propagation characteristics of 526GHz submillimeter-wave coupled image guide situated on a solid-state plasma slab were investigated by simulation using the finite-difference time-domain (FDTD) method, and the results were compared with those of the experiments employing n-InSb as the plasma material. Coupling characteristics can be widely controlled by applying a magnetic field to the plasma material. It indicates the possibility of constructing submillimeter-wave devices in the future such as variable couplers using the above-mentioned structure.
